Why is human factors engineering important in designing safer healthcare processes?

Explanation:
Human factors engineering in healthcare focuses on designing processes, tools, and environments that align with how people think and act. By accounting for limitations in memory, attention, perception, and workload, it helps reduce errors before they happen. A practical example is using standardized checklists during handoffs; these anchors ensure critical information is communicated consistently, reducing omissions and miscommunication even when teams are tired or interrupted.
